What is Required to Enroll in LVN Programs in Angler TX
The requirements for LVN courses differ from one program to the next, but most will have some standard ones. One must have graduated from high school or have a GED or equivalent, be the legal age to work for Texas, clear a criminal background check, and last but not least you must test negative for illegal drugs to be qualified for registration.

Online LVN Programs – What You Can Expect
So, have you reached the point where you are ready to decide which LVN programs are best for you? You may be told that online LVN programs are all identical, however there are some things you will want to consider when choosing which LVN Training to register for in Angler TX. Before enrolling and signing a commitment with the school you’ve selected, it’s highly encouraged that you verify the certification history of the training with the Texas State Board. Although they are not as crucial as the school’s accreditation status, you may want to seriously look into a few of the following parts too:
- Check with your state’s board of nursing to see how well the program ranks among its peers
- Exactly what is the rate of success on the license examination in comparison with competing schools?
- Credentials of course instructors
